Obverse description Left-facing veiled bust of Queen Victoria wearing a small crown, set within a raised inner circle. The engraver's signature R. NEAL appears in the lower field below the bust, with a circular legend around the periphery and a small decorative cross motif at the base. A suspension hole is pierced at the top.

Reverse description A quartered heraldic shield in high relief displaying the combined arms of St. Margaret and St. John Westminster, flanked by decorative scrollwork supporters. A circular legend surrounds the shield, and a suspension hole is pierced at the top.
